What Determines Your Malibu's Value in the Arizona Market
Several factors shape what your Chevrolet Malibu is worth, and Arizona's unique environment plays a real role. The intense desert sun that beats down on Mammoth and the surrounding area affects both exterior paint and interior materials over time. UV damage, faded trim, and cracked dashboards are common in older vehicles that spent years parked outside in the open. Buyers and appraisers account for this, so condition relative to age matters significantly here. Mileage is always a major factor. A Malibu with highway miles accumulated on the US-77 corridor typically holds up differently than one that spent most of its life on rough unpaved roads near the San Pedro. The trim level — whether you're selling an LS, LT, or Premier — influences value as well, since features like a backup camera, heated seats, or a turbocharged engine appeal to a broader pool of buyers. Service history also matters. If you have records showing oil changes, transmission service, or major repairs, that documentation adds credibility and can positively influence your offer. Even if your paperwork isn't complete, an honest description of the vehicle's mechanical condition goes a long way.
Selling a Malibu With a Loan Still on It
Many Mammoth residents who want to sell their Malibu still have an outstanding auto loan. This is common, and it doesn't make the sale impossible — it just adds a step. What's My Car Worth Arizona works through these situations regularly. When you submit your vehicle information, simply note that there's a lien on the title. The payoff amount from your lender will be factored into the transaction. If the offer for your Malibu exceeds what you owe, the difference comes to you after the loan is paid off. If you owe more than the vehicle's current market value — a situation sometimes called negative equity — that gap will need to be addressed. In some cases, sellers can roll that difference into a new financing arrangement, but the more important first step is simply knowing where you stand. Direct Sale vs. Trading In at a Dealership — What You Should Know
When Mammoth residents think about getting rid of a vehicle, trading it in is often the first idea that comes to mind. It seems convenient — hand over the keys and roll the value into the next purchase. But trade-in values are almost always lower than what you'd receive through a direct sale. The reason is simple: when a dealership takes your Malibu as a trade, they need to account for reconditioning costs, lot fees, and their own profit margin before they ever price it for resale.
